Overview
This review examines 2027 Mercedes-Benz CLA220 Hybrid, a compact hybrid sedan documented for the US market, through powertrain; power and output; claims and estimates.
Powertrain
The CLA220 combines a Miller-cycle turbocharged 1.5-liter four-cylinder, an electric motor integrated into an eight-speed dual-clutch transmission, and a 1.3-kWh battery.

Power and Output
Published reporting states system output of 208 horsepower and 280 pound-feet, with front- and all-wheel-drive versions planned.

Claims and Estimates
Mercedes estimates 7.1 seconds to 60 mph for the front-wheel-drive car; this is a manufacturer estimate rather than an instrumented result.
